作为一名IT从业人员,熟练掌握Linux常用命令是必不可少的技能。本文将以分享Linux常用命令及其用法为主题,介绍15个常用命令,并详细描述它们的使用方法和技巧。通过学习这些命令,读者将能够更加高效地管理和操作Linux系统,提升工作效率。
1.pwd:显示当前所在目录的路径
pwd命令用于显示当前所在目录的路径。在命令行中输入pwd即可,系统会返回当前目录的完整路径,方便用户了解当前所在位置。
2.ls:列出当前目录下的文件和子目录
ls命令用于列出当前目录下的文件和子目录。常用选项包括-l(显示详细信息)、-a(显示所有文件,包括隐藏文件)等。
3.cd:切换目录
cd命令用于切换当前目录。通过输入cd加上目标目录的路径,可以快速切换到指定目录下进行操作。
4.mkdir:创建新目录
mkdir命令用于创建新目录。可以通过输入mkdir加上目录名的方式,快速创建新的目录。
5.touch:创建新文件或更新文件时间
touch命令用于创建新文件或更新文件的时间。通过输入touch加上文件名的方式,可以快速创建新的文件,或者更新已有文件的时间戳。
6.cp:复制文件和目录
cp命令用于复制文件和目录。通过输入cp加上源文件/目录和目标位置的方式,可以将源文件/目录复制到指定位置。
7.mv:移动文件和目录
mv命令用于移动文件和目录。通过输入mv加上源文件/目录和目标位置的方式,可以将源文件/目录移动到指定位置。
8.rm:删除文件和目录
rm命令用于删除文件和目录。通过输入rm加上要删除的文件/目录的路径,可以快速删除指定的文件或目录。
9.cat:查看文件内容
cat命令用于查看文件的内容。通过输入cat加上文件名的方式,系统会将文件的内容输出到终端上,方便用户查看。
10.grep:在文件中查找指定内容
grep命令用于在文件中查找指定内容。通过输入grep加上要查找的内容和目标文件名的方式,系统会返回包含该内容的所有行。
11.chmod:修改文件权限
chmod命令用于修改文件的权限。通过输入chmod加上权限模式和目标文件名的方式,可以修改文件的读、写、执行权限。
12.tar:压缩和解压文件
tar命令用于压缩和解压文件。通过输入tar加上不同选项和目标文件名的方式,可以实现对文件或目录的压缩和解压缩操作。
13.find:在文件系统中搜索文件
find命令用于在文件系统中搜索文件。通过输入find加上搜索路径和搜索条件的方式,可以快速定位到符合条件的文件。
14.top:实时查看系统资源占用情况
top命令用于实时查看系统资源的占用情况。在命令行中输入top,系统会显示当前运行的进程及其资源占用情况,方便用户进行系统性能监控。
15.history:查看和执行历史命令
history命令用于查看和执行历史命令。通过输入history,系统会返回用户最近执行过的命令列表,用户可以选择重新执行某个历史命令。
通过本文介绍的15个常用Linux命令,读者可以全面了解这些命令的使用方法和技巧,从而提升在Linux系统上的工作效率。熟练掌握这些命令不仅可以加快工作速度,还可以更好地管理和操作Linux系统,为日常工作带来便利。希望本文对读者在学习和使用Linux常用命令时有所帮助。
Linux常用命令及用法详解
Linux是一种开源的操作系统,拥有强大的灵活性和可定制性,因此在服务器和网络管理中得到广泛应用。掌握一些常用的Linux命令及其用法,对于运维人员来说是必不可少的。本文将详细介绍15个常用命令及其用法,以帮助读者更好地理解和使用Linux操作系统。
一:cd命令:进入指定目录
cd命令用于改变当前所在的目录,只需输入cd命令后跟目标目录的路径即可进入该目录。输入cd/home/username将进入用户的主目录。
二:ls命令:列出目录内容
ls命令用于列出当前目录的内容,包括文件和子目录。输入ls命令后,系统会返回当前目录下的所有文件和文件夹的列表。
三:cp命令:复制文件或目录
cp命令用于复制文件或目录。通过指定源文件/目录和目标文件/目录的路径,可以将文件或目录从一个位置复制到另一个位置。
四:rm命令:删除文件或目录
rm命令用于删除文件或目录。使用rm命令要谨慎,因为删除的文件或目录无法恢复。可以通过添加选项来指定删除行为,例如使用-r选项可以删除整个目录。
五:mv命令:移动文件或目录
mv命令用于移动文件或目录,也可以用于重命名文件或目录。通过指定源文件/目录和目标文件/目录的路径,可以将文件或目录从一个位置移动到另一个位置。
六:cat命令:查看文件内容
cat命令用于显示文件的内容。通过输入cat命令后跟文件名,系统会将文件的内容输出到终端上。
七:grep命令:在文件中搜索指定内容
grep命令用于在文件中搜索指定的字符串或模式。通过输入grep命令后跟要搜索的字符串和文件名,系统会返回包含该字符串的行。
八:chmod命令:修改文件权限
chmod命令用于修改文件的权限。通过输入chmod命令后跟权限值和文件名,可以更改文件的读、写、执行权限。
九:chown命令:修改文件所有者
chown命令用于修改文件的所有者。通过输入chown命令后跟新的所有者和文件名,可以将文件的所有权转移到其他用户。
十:ps命令:查看系统进程
ps命令用于查看当前系统正在运行的进程。通过输入ps命令后,系统会返回正在运行的进程列表,包括进程ID、进程状态等信息。
十一:top命令:动态监控系统状态
top命令用于实时监控系统的状态。通过输入top命令后,系统会以交互式界面展示当前系统的CPU使用率、内存使用情况、进程信息等。
十二:ping命令:测试网络连接
ping命令用于测试与指定IP地址的主机之间的网络连接。通过输入ping命令后跟IP地址,系统会向该IP地址发送网络请求,并显示网络延迟和丢包情况。
十三:ifconfig命令:配置网络接口
ifconfig命令用于配置和显示网络接口的状态。通过输入ifconfig命令后,系统会返回当前网络接口的IP地址、子网掩码、网关等信息。
十四:wget命令:下载文件
wget命令用于从网络上下载文件。通过输入wget命令后跟文件的URL地址,系统会自动下载该文件到当前目录。
十五:ssh命令:远程登录服务器
ssh命令用于远程登录服务器。通过输入ssh命令后跟服务器的IP地址和用户名,可以与服务器建立安全的远程连接。
本文介绍了15个常用的Linux命令及其用法,涵盖了目录操作、文件管理、网络管理等多个方面。通过学习和掌握这些命令,读者可以更高效地进行Linux系统的运维工作。希望本文对于初学者和运维人员有所帮助。